Mutual of Omaha Medicare Supplement Insurance members receive valuable vision care savings through the EyeMed vision plan. The supplemental Medicare plan automatically includes the eye care and eywear savings with the vision plan at no additional cost to the insured.

Routine eye exams not only help correct vision problems; comprehensive eye exams can also reveal the warning signs of more serious undiagnosed health problems such as hypertension, cardiovascular disease and diabetes in Mutual of Omaha Medicare supplement policyholders. Early diagnosis of these conditions provides benefits to the client and Mutual of Omaha Insurance Company by reducing more costly services down the road.

Site-threatening coditions such as cataracts and macular degeneration often occur as we age. Detecting these conditions and preventing irreversible damage can be accomplished with routine comprehensive eye exams.

Presenting the Mutual of Omaha ID card entitles the insured to unlimited savings with the EyeMed vision plan. Some of the significant value-added features of the vision plan include:

1. Eye exams for $50

2. Up to $140 savings on frames at 40%

3. Discounted lenses and other lense options at fixed prices

4. Add-ons and services at 30% off

With EyeMed, access to quality eye care and eyewear is convenient to all Mutual of Omaha Medicare Supplemental customers. Members have the choice of thousands of providers nationwide including leading optical retailers or private practitioners. Mutual of Omaha Medigap plan customers can save on the exam and eyewear at on location or choose the provider thats right for their eye care needs. The eye care prescription can be filled at many convenient locations.

Lens Crafters, Pearle Vision, Sears Optical, Target Optical, J.C. Penney and many other providers are available for the Mutual of Omaha Medicare supplement policyholders to choose from.
